‘You’d have to pay me to return’: TOM PARKER BOWLES review the first of the revamped Olympia’s new restaurants

A grand new restaurant in the revamped Olympia looks the part – but sadly falls flat

It’s certainly been a long time in the making. The new Olympia, that is: a grand and ambitious project that aims to give the rather faded Victorian grande dame not just a much-needed facelift, but a whole new lease of life, with a live music venue, two hotels, offices, bars and all the rest. I live around the corner, and the refurb has gone on for decades. Or so it seems. Anyway, it’s all looking very impressive indeed.
